Welcome to today's Guided Prayer, where we invite you to find a quiet space to still your mind and body.
Guided Prayers are a daily 5–10 minute, intentionally created moment to slow down and meet with God—through scripture, reflection, and honest prayer.
It’s not a program you attend.
It’s a pathway you practice.
A guided space where people can stop, breathe, and connect with Jesus—every single day.
Have you ever woken up with your heart racing, your mind full, the feeling like there's not enough hours in the day, even before your feet hit the ground? Maybe this isn't you, or isn't you right now. But maybe there is an area of your life where you feel like your methods, your planning, your strategizing still aren't cutting it. Listen to the invitation of Jesus today. Come to me, all you who are weary and burdened, and I will give you rest. Anxiety exhausts the soul. Striving and trying to control drains us. But Jesus invites you to rest, not by fixing everything, but by coming close to Him. Thank Jesus for inviting you into rest, for offering relief where you've been tense and tired. Next, tell him where your soul feels wary. Ask him to trade your anxious thoughts for his gentle rest. Or maybe you resonate with the picture of trying to control God, outcomes the future, and you need to pray and trade your human attempts at control for trust and rest in his goodness and sovereignty. We choose to come to you, God. Would you repeat that audibly if you can? I choose to come to you, God. I choose to come to you, God. I choose to come to you, God. Amen.
